A Chip Off the Old Tooth


It finally happened. The event I have been having nightmares about since my middle school years. I dropped my fake tooth in the shower and the top of it chipped off.

Let me explain. I was born without 2 of my permanent teeth. One of the missing teeth is a molar, so I don't worry about it. The other is the next-door-neighbor to my front tooth. That one I worry about. I have had a fake tooth since middle school, and I got what's called a "flipper" (a mouthpiece type-thing with an attached tooth) a few weeks before Devin and I got married. This is a very nice fix to my missing tooth problem, except that it is not permanent and I need to remove it when I brush my teeth, which leads to the tragedy that occurred on Friday.
